You’re wrong on many levels here. First, sitting doesn’t put any “kinks” in your colon. Second, unless you’ve been backed up for days when you poo, it is coming from your rectum, NOT your colon. If there’s no poo in your rectum you aren’t going to have the urge to go.

Squatting does increase the pressure in the abdominal cavity which is why it practically flies out of you when you squat. When you sit on a Western style toilet you have to apply a lot of muscular effort (valsalva) to increase the pressure in the abdominal cavity.
